Backpacking Basics: Exploring America's Wilderness on Foot exploring
Lace up your boots and hit the trail! Backpacking is a thrilling way to experience the raw beauty of America's wilderness. Whether you're a seasoned hiker or just starting out, mastering the fundamentals will set you up for a safe and unforgettable adventure. First things first, choose your gear wisely. A comfortable backpack, durable boots, and weather-appropriate clothing are crucial. Pack plenty of food and water, as resupply options can be limited in remote areas.
- Before you head out, familiarize yourself with the trail map and weather forecast.
- master your navigation skills using a compass and topographic maps.
- Leave no trace behind; pack out everything you pack in.
Remember to respect the environment and its inhabitants. Embrace in the solitude, the stunning views, and the sense of accomplishment that comes with reaching here your destination. Happy hiking!

Gear Up & Get Going: Your First Backpacking Trip Across the U.S.{
Packing for your first cross-country backpacking trip is sure to be a daunting task. Fear not, though! With a little foresight, you can successfully gather the essentials and embark on your journey.
Start by picking a durable backpack that suits your expectations. Next, fill it with essential clothing items like layers for warmth, rain gear, and comfortable hiking shoes.
Remember to include a first-aid kit, water purification system, headlamp, and a GPS. Don't overlook food that is high-energy.
